A polymer material is a substance composed of high molecular weight molecules known as macromolecules. These macromolecules consist of numerous repeating subunits.
Thermoplastic Polymers: Examine our thermoplastic polymers. They are known for their formability and recyclability. They are used in consumer goods and automotive components. Our polymers meet specific design requirements and industry standards.
Thermosetting Polymers: Investigate our thermosetting polymers. Heat‐induced cross-linking produces materials with long service lives. They are applied in aerospace, electronics and industrial processes that require extended durability.
Biodegradable Polymers: Consider our biodegradable polymers for sustainable applications. They provide environmentally responsible solutions for disposable items and packaging. Their natural degradation reduces environmental impact.
Polymer Blends and Alloys: Our polymer blends and alloys combine distinct properties. They are engineered by merging the characteristics of different polymers. This results in materials that satisfy application-specific requirements.
